Black and white view of Worcester Cathedral seen from the River Severn, with swans swimming in the foreground. The printed text at the bottom indicates 'WORCESTER CATHEDRAL FROM RIVER SEVERN 47'. On the reverse, a handwritten letter dated October 4, 1952, addressed to Madame Gerielle G. Aujac in Paris, mentions a holiday in Worcester and travel plans to France. A 2 shillings 6 pence stamp (King George VI) is affixed, with a postmark from 'WORCESTER' dated October 14, 1952.
